Scientific Linux 4.x: xorg-x11 Security Advisory For Local Privileges

Moderate: xorg-x11 security update. Date: Thu, 12 Jul 2007 17:55:00 -0500 Reply-To: Connie Sieh Sender: Security Errata for Scientific Linux From: Connie Sieh Subject: Security ERRATA for xorg-x11 on SL4.x i386/x86_64 Comments: To: scientific Synopsis: Moderate: xorg-x11 security update CVE Names: CVE-2007-3103 Description: A temporary file flaw was found in the way the X.Org X11 xfs font server startup script executes. A local user could modify the permissions of the file of their choosing, possibly elevating their local privileges (CVE-2007-3103). Red Hat: RHSA-2005:069-01 Critical: Perl DBI File Exploit

An updated perl-DBI package that fixes a temporary file flaw in DBI::ProxyServer is now available.. - --------------------------------------------------------------------- Red Hat Security Advisory Synopsis: Updated perl-DBI package fixes security issue Advisory ID: RHSA-2005:069-01 Advisory URL: https://access.redhat.com/errata/RHSA-2005:069.html Issue date: 2005-02-01 Updated on: 2005-02-01 Product: Red Hat Enterprise Linux CVE Names: CAN-2005-0077 - ---------------------------------------------------------------------1. Summary: An updated perl-DBI package that fixes a temporary file flaw in DBI::ProxyServer is now available. 2. Relevant releases/architectures: Red Hat Enterprise Linux AS (Advanced Server) version 2.1 - i386, ia64 Red Hat Linux Advanced Workstation 2.1 - ia64 Red Hat Enterprise Linux ES version 2.1 - i386 Red Hat Enterprise Linux WS version 2.1 - i386 Red Hat Enterprise Linux AS version 3 - i386, ia64, ppc, s390, s390x, x86_64 Red Hat Desktop version 3 - i386, x86_64 Red Hat Enterprise Linux ES version 3 - i386, ia64, x86_64 Red Hat Enterprise Linux WS version 3 - i386, ia64, x86_64 3. Problem description: DBI is a database access Application Programming Interface (API) for the Perl programming language. The Debian Security Audit Project discovered that the DBI library creates a temporary PID file in an insecure manner. A local user could overwrite or create files as a different user who happens to run an application which uses DBI::ProxyServer. The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ures project (cve.mitre.org) has assigned the name CAN-2005-0077 to this issue. Users should update to this erratum package which disables the temporary PID file unless configured. 4.
